Winslow Man Charged in Murder of Woman Found by Roadside Friday Morning
Kevin Ambrose allegedly stabbed his girlfriend in front of her five-year-old daughter, according to the Courier Post.
A Winslow man has been charged in connection with the murder of a woman found on the side of the road in Winslow early Friday morning, Camden County Prosecutor Mary Eva Colalillo and Winslow Police Chief Robert Stimelski announced.
Kevin Ambrose, 52, was charged with the murder of 41-year-old Jennifer Bongco, also of Winslow.
Her body was found at Erial and Wiltons Landing Road in Winslow about 12:30 a.m. after Amrbose allegedly stabbed her multiple times after 12:10 a.m. Friday morning.

Members of the U.S. Marshals arrested Ambrose in Atlantic City Friday night.
According to the Courier Post, Ambrose was arrested at the Tropicana Casino, where he had a hotel room.

Bongco was his girlfriend, and he allegedly stabbed her in front of Bongco’s five-year-old daughter, according to the report.
